Stream Smart TV audio to LAN speakers

I have a Samsung Smart TV ue48h6200 & Sony Airplay/Lan/audio Jack Speakers Sony RDP-X700IP (1x) & SA-N310 (2x) and wish to improve audio from my TV to these speakers. Is it possible to connect them all with my the Netgear Nighthawk R7500-100PES X4 AC2350 to stream the audio from my TV to these speakers ?

Thanks for your help.

Best regards

Olivier

 

  • You should do your own research to confirm the following. It looks like Samsung Smart TV's can send sound over Wi-Fi, but only to Samsung Multiroom compatible speakers. I think you are out of luck with your streaming to Sony speakers. Source: Samsung Smart TV manual.

     

    Why don't you connect the audio out of the TV to the audio in of the speakers using an audio cable?
